Output 31dcbeba7a848b3a54f0e219ed2555993fa2ce1ee19f199e5a3c5e816069983b:0

value
1182338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c35879276e87b036eb1f134e7a57f53620b60ee OP_EQUAL
address
3JrB5udSBDuJ3Y2L3pa6wfQeoFEBb8ZtSa
transaction
31dcbeba7a848b3a54f0e219ed2555993fa2ce1ee19f199e5a3c5e816069983b
spent
true